Package: plutor 0.1.0

plutor: Useful Functions for Visualization

In ancient Roman mythology, 'Pluto' was the ruler of the underworld and presides over the afterlife. 'Pluto' was frequently conflated with 'Plutus', the god of wealth, because mineral wealth was found underground. When plotting with R, you try once, twice, practice again and again, and finally you get a pretty figure you want. It's a 'plot tour', a tour about repetition and reward. Hope 'plutor' helps you on the tour!

Authors:William Song [aut, cre]

plutor_0.1.0.tar.gz
plutor_0.1.0.zip(r-4.5)plutor_0.1.0.zip(r-4.4)plutor_0.1.0.zip(r-4.3)
plutor_0.1.0.tgz(r-4.4-any)plutor_0.1.0.tgz(r-4.3-any)
plutor_0.1.0.tar.gz(r-4.5-noble)plutor_0.1.0.tar.gz(r-4.4-noble)
plutor_0.1.0.tgz(r-4.4-emscripten)plutor_0.1.0.tgz(r-4.3-emscripten)
plutor.pdf |plutor.html
plutor/json (API)

# Install 'plutor' in R:
install.packages('plutor', repos = c('https://william-swl.r-universe.dev', 'https://cloud.r-project.org'))

Peer review:

Bug tracker:https://github.com/william-swl/plutor/issues

Datasets:

On CRAN:

49 exports 2 stars 1.18 score 92 dependencies 28 scripts 181 downloads

Last updated 11 months agofrom:56eaa462f6. Checks:OK: 7. Indexed: yes.

TargetResultDate
Doc / VignettesOKAug 24 2024
R-4.5-winOKAug 24 2024
R-4.5-linuxOKAug 24 2024
R-4.4-winOKAug 24 2024
R-4.4-macOKAug 24 2024
R-4.3-winOKAug 24 2024
R-4.3-macOKAug 24 2024

Exports:%>%assign_colorsbrewer_colorscm2incm2inchcm2ptextract_comparegeom_comparegeom_describegeom2trace.GeomComparegeom2trace.GeomDescribeGeomCompareGeomDescribegradient_colorsin2cmin2mminch2cminch2mmlptmm2inmm2inchmm2ptpl_initpl_savepl_sizeplot_colorsposition_floatxPLposition_floatyPLPositionFloatxPLPositionFloatyPLpptpt2cmpt2mmrevert_pos_scalescale_elescale_x_continuous_plscale_x_log10_plscale_y_continuous_plscale_y_log10_plsci_colorsStatCompareStatCountPLStatDescribeStatFuncPLStatMeanPLtheme_pltheme_pl0tpttrans_pos_scale

Dependencies:baizerbase64encbitbit64bslibcacachemcellrangerclicliprclustercodetoolscolorspacecpp11crayoncurldiffobjdigestdplyrevaluatefansifarverfastmapfontawesomeforeachfsgclusgenericsggh4xggplot2ggscigluegtablehighrhmshtmltoolsisobanditeratorsjquerylibjsonliteknitrlabelinglatticelifecyclemagrittrMASSMatrixmemoisemgcvmimemunsellnlmeopenxlsxpermutepillarpkgconfigprettyunitsprogresspurrrqapR6rappdirsRColorBrewerRcppreadrreadxlregistryrematchrematch2reprrlangrmarkdownsassscalesseriationstringistringrtibbletidyrtidyselecttinytexTSPtzdbutf8vctrsveganviridisLitevroomwithrxfunyamlzip

Readme and manuals

Help Manual

Help pageTopics
assign colors by a column in a tibble, for the convenience to use 'scale_color_identity()'assign_colors
colors of nucleotides and amino acidsbioletter_colors
select colors from 'RColorBrewer' package presetsbrewer_colors
width and height of built-in canvascanvas_size
trans cm to inchcm2inch
trans cm to ptcm2pt
extract the result of 'geom_compare' from a 'ggplot' objectextract_compare
add p value and fold change on a plotgeom_compare
Description values plotgeom_describe
geom2trace.GeomComparegeom2trace.GeomCompare
geom2trace.GeomDescribegeom2trace.GeomDescribe
GeomCompareGeomCompare
GeomDescribeGeomDescribe
generate gradient colorsgradient_colors
trans inch to cmcm2in in2cm inch2cm
trans inch to mmin2mm inch2mm
trans geom line point and theme line point to the real pointlpt
Minimal tibble dataset adjusted from diamondmini_diamond
trans mm to inchmm2in mm2inch
trans mm to ptmm2pt
set size, resolution and default themepl_init
save plot, support save into a blank canvaspl_save
set repr size and resolutionpl_size
plot colorsplot_colors
a new Position object to create float x positionposition_floatxPL
a new Position object to create float y positionposition_floatyPL
PositionFloatxPLPositionFloatxPL
PositionFloatyPLPositionFloatyPL
trans pt to cmpt2cm
trans pt to mmpt2mm
revert the position scale transformationrevert_pos_scale
scale element according to a vector of element scalesscale_ele
A variant of 'scale_x_continuous()' to show axis minor breaksscale_x_continuous_pl
A variant of 'scale_x_log10()' to show axis minor breaks and better axis labelsscale_x_log10_pl
A variant of 'scale_y_continuous()' to show axis minor breaksscale_y_continuous_pl
A variant of 'scale_y_log10()' to show axis minor breaks and better axis labelsscale_y_log10_pl
select colors from 'ggsci' package presetssci_colors
StatCompareStatCompare
StatCountPLStatCountPL
StatDescribeStatDescribe
StatFuncPLStatFuncPL
StatMeanPLStatMeanPL
a new extensible themetheme_pl
a blank themetheme_pl0
trans geom text or point to the real pointppt tpt
perform the position scale transformationtrans_pos_scale